[NEWSboard IBMi Forum]

Hybrid View

  1. #1
    Registriert seit
    Oct 2003
    Beiträge
    152

    nicht nachvollhziehbar

    Ich habe nach einem mißglückten Rel.Wechsel auf einer 520 von 5.3 auf 6.1 die aktuelle 21er Sicherung mit einer Scratch-Installation von V5R3M5 wieder zurückgedreht. Alles läuft normal. Jetzt sagt der Kunde, eine Anwenduing, die über MS Query und MS Access via ODBC Daten aus einer i5 Datenbankdatei extrahiert und die als ANSI-Datei auf einen PC überträgt, bis zum Umstellungstag " als Trennzeichen zwischen den Feldern einsetzt, seit der Rückspeicherung nun aber ; einfügt. Kann das irgendetwas mit der Rücksicherung zu tun haben?

  2. #2
    Registriert seit
    Aug 2003
    Beiträge
    1.508
    Habt ihr auch eine neue Version vom Client Access installiert?
    Vielleicht arbeitet der ODBC-Job jetzt mit einer anderen CCSID?

  3. #3
    Registriert seit
    Oct 2003
    Beiträge
    152
    Zitat Zitat von andreaspr@aon.at Beitrag anzeigen
    Habt ihr auch eine neue Version vom Client Access installiert?
    Vielleicht arbeitet der ODBC-Job jetzt mit einer anderen CCSID?
    Nein, es wurde ja die 21er Sicherung zurück gespielt. Wo wird denn die CCSID festgelegt? Doch in der physischen Dateibeschreibung, in die wurde doch zurück gespielt?

  4. #4
    Registriert seit
    Aug 2003
    Beiträge
    1.508
    Ich meinte ob ihr auch das neue Client Access am PC installiert habt.
    Das mit den CCSIDs hab ich ehrlich gesagt noch nicht komplett durchschaut. Tabellen (DSPFD), Jobs (DSPJOB) und sogar auch Programme (DSPPGM) haben eine CCSID.
    Ich weis jedoch nicht ob es daran liegen könnt. Das ist zumindest das erste was mir bei dem ganzen einfällt.

  5. #5
    Registriert seit
    Aug 2006
    Beiträge
    2.114
    Ich würde eher darauf tippen das der PC sich umgestellt hat.
    Vielleicht beim ersten Versuch Daten von der neuen Kiste zu laden, und hat sich dann beim Laden von der alten Kiste nicht mehr zurückgestellt.

    GG

  6. #6
    Registriert seit
    Oct 2003
    Beiträge
    152
    Zitat Zitat von KingofKning Beitrag anzeigen
    Ich würde eher darauf tippen das der PC sich umgestellt hat.
    Vielleicht beim ersten Versuch Daten von der neuen Kiste zu laden, und hat sich dann beim Laden von der alten Kiste nicht mehr zurückgestellt.

    GG
    Es gab keine "neue Kiste" Die 520 ist nicht über den Laden des LIC von der Load Source nach der Installation desselbigen nicht mehr hoch gekommen. Es gab folglich kein 5761XW1 auf der Maschine ...

  7. #7
    Registriert seit
    Feb 2001
    Beiträge
    20.695
    Das Trennzeichen hat mit der CCSID überhaupt nichts zu tun sondern wird in den jeweiligen Übertragungen angegeben.
    Hier ist die Frage, wie die Bereitstellung erfolgt.
    Wenn du ggf. CPYxxxIMPF hast du den CMD-Default für FLDDLM geändert.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  8. #8
    Registriert seit
    Oct 2003
    Beiträge
    152
    Zitat Zitat von Fuerchau Beitrag anzeigen
    Das Trennzeichen hat mit der CCSID überhaupt nichts zu tun sondern wird in den jeweiligen Übertragungen angegeben.
    Hier ist die Frage, wie die Bereitstellung erfolgt.
    Habe das mit dem Kunden noch mal verifiziert. Die Übertragung erfolgt wie folgt: MSQuery greift via ODBC auf 2 AS400 Datenbankdateien zu, selektiert Sätze und gibt die als .csv Datei auf den PC aus. In dieser .csv Datei waren halt die Trennzeichen bis zu dem Restore " als Trennzeichen, jetzt sind es halt ; Der Kunde schwört Stein und Bein, den PC nicht angefasst zu haben.

  9. #9
    Registriert seit
    Feb 2001
    Beiträge
    20.695
    Da kann er schwören was er will, ODBC fügt keine Trennzeichen an, das macht alles alleine Excel.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  10. #10
    Registriert seit
    Aug 2006
    Beiträge
    2.114
    Du könntest doch mal die Abfrage selber machen auf Deinen Rechner und dabei vielleicht auch mal das SQL-Trace aktivieren.
    Wobei " als Trennzeichen schon ungewöhnlich ist.
    Was steht den eigentlich in der Systemsteuerung unter Regionalen Einstellungen beim POunkt Listentrennzeichen?

    GG

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• You may not post attachments
  • You may not edit your posts
  •